Early Childcare Assistant
- Assisted in the planning and execution of special events, such as holiday celebrations or field trips, to foster a sense of community within the childcare center.
- Observed strict adherence to licensing standards by following established policies on safety procedures, food preparation guidelines, and sanitation practices.
- Communicated regularly with parents regarding their child''s progress, achievements, and areas for growth.
- Established strong relationships with families through open communication channels such as parent-teacher conferences or daily check-ins at drop-off/pick-up times.
- Contributed to maintaining clean and organized classrooms to ensure a productive learning environment for all students.
- Monitored daily health checks of each child upon arrival at the facility to ensure safety and well-being of all students.
- Collaborated with lead teachers on lesson planning, assessment strategies, and curriculum development.
- Enhanced children''s cognitive development by implementing engaging and age-appropriate learning activities.
- Effectively managed classroom behavior by implementing consistent rules and routines for all students.
- Fostered social-emotional development in young children by promoting sharing, empathy, and cooperation.
- Promoted physical development by leading outdoor activities, games, and group exercises suitable for young children.
- Developed creative arts programs that encouraged self-expression, fine motor skills improvement, and artistic exploration among students.
- Supported early literacy skills through storytelling, reading books, and teaching letter recognition.
